About this role:

Wells Fargo is seeking an Associate Operations Processor as part of the Wire Transfer department. Learn more about the career areas and business divisions at wellsfargojobs.com
 

The successful Associate Operations Processor will demonstrate strong attention to detail, organizational skills, ability to follow procedures, and basic computer knowledge.  They have the desire and motivation to constantly improve their ability to perform each function quickly and accurately.


In this role, you will:

  • Perform general clerical operations tasks that are routine in nature
  • Receive, log, batch, and distribute work
  • File, photocopy, and answer phones
  • Prepare and distribute incoming and outgoing mail
  • Regularly receive direction from supervisor and escalate questions and issues to more experienced roles
  • Work under close supervision following established procedures
  • Support Operations in completing complex business, operational, and customer support initiatives and overall effectiveness of team performance
  • Use technical expertise in the designated area and resolve escalated issues
  • Perform complex operational and customer support initiatives within Operations functional area
  • Apply technical knowledge and expertise to perform work and action requests
  • Collaborate and consult with peers, colleagues, and managers to resolve issues and achieve goals
  • Interact with internal customers
  • Receive direction from leaders and exercise independent judgment while developing the knowledge to understand function, policies, procedures, and compliance requirements


Required Qualifications:

  • 6+ months of operations support exper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, education


Desired Qualifications:

  • Experience supporting wire transfer operations and related payment processing activities.
  • Knowledge of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) regulations and compliance requirements.
  • Previous production or operations experience in a fast-paced, high-volume environment.
  • Quality Control (QC) and/or Quality Assurance (QA) experience.
  • Working knowledge of GSMOS and Fircosoft systems.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ications, including Word and Excel.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ize tasks, meet deadlines, and perform effectively under pressure.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and commitment to accuracy.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ively within a team environment.
  • Demonstrated ability to work independently with minimal supervision.

About Wells Fargo

Wells Fargo & Company (NYSE: WFC) is a leading financial services company that has approximately $2.1 trillion in assets. We provide a diversified set of banking, investment and mortgage products and services, as well as consumer and commercial finance, through our four reportable operating segments: Consumer Banking and Lending, Commercial Banking, Corporate and Investment Banking, and Wealth & Investment Management.
